Overview of Installation and Removal

Install/remove components by using the following procedure.
1.
If the server is ON, turn it off.
Refer to Chapter 3 (6. Turning off the Server).
2.
Disconnect the power cord from the outlet and the server.
3.
Disconnect all cables connected to the connector at the rear.
4.
Remove the side cover.
Refer to Chapter 2 (1.4. Removing the Side Cover).
5.
Remove the front bezel if applicable.
Refer to Chapter 2 (1.5 Removing the Front Bezel).
6.
Depending on the components to be installed or removed, follow the procedure in order.
Refer to Chapter 2 (1.6 Internal Flash Memory to 1.14 Backup devices).
7.
Connect cables
Refer to Chapter 2 (1.15 Connecting cables).
8.
Attach the front bezel.
Refer to Chapter 2 (1.16 Attaching the Front Bezel).
9.
Attach the side cover.
Refer to Chapter 2 (1.17 Installing the Side Cover).
This is the end of the installation or removal procedures for internal optional devices.
Continue the setup with reference to Chapter 2 (2.2 Connection).
